  • Thanks for the AUA! Really excited about the Mega Release and even more for the future after!

    My question is regarding Nate's original proposal for the KDE goals "Professionalise KDE" if I remember well. Now, I know that the goal was changed and the scope reduced to "Automatization and Systematization" but I truly believe the original proposal's spirit could have a huge impact on the whole ecosystem.

    For example I remember the proposal contained the plan to hire a person working "full time" on actively finding fundings and grants and applying to them. We got the Mega Release fundraiser but for example on the forum I found https://discuss.kde.org/t/formalities-for-stf-funding/9916 and it looks like a waste of potential to not apply for grants because no one has the time to do so.

    Is there anyone at KDE, maybe among the Board, who is still trying to make the "Professionalise KDE" happen?
